Can Wisdom Teeth Return After Being Pulled?

Months or even years after undergoing third molar extraction, feeling a sharp, hard white structure poking through the gum tissue can be deeply alarming. Many patients immediately panic, wondering if their wisdom tooth was incompletely removed or if human teeth possess an unexpected ability to regenerate. The straightforward biological truth brings instant reassurance: once an adult wisdom tooth is extracted, it cannot biologically regrow.

However, the human oral cavity undergoes intricate, prolonged remodeling following surgical tooth extraction. Bone remodeling, migrating root tips, and rare developmental anomalies can create sensations and visible symptoms that mimic tooth regrowth. 1. The Biology of Human Dentition: Why Permanent Teeth Never Regenerate

To understand why wisdom teeth cannot grow back, one must examine human dental embryology. Humans are diphyodont organisms, meaning our genetic blueprint permits only two successive sets of teeth: primary deciduous (baby) teeth and permanent succedaneous teeth. Third molars represent the terminal members of the permanent dentition.

Tooth organogenesis is controlled by the dental lamina, an embryonic band of epithelial tissue that buds into individual tooth germs during fetal and early childhood development. Once each tooth develops its enamel organ, dental papilla, and coronal enamel, the dental lamina undergoes programmed apoptosis (cellular degeneration) and disintegrates. Unlike polyphyodont species such as sharks or alligators, which maintain active stem cell niches along a permanent dental lamina, humans do not retain the cellular machinery to generate new tooth crowns, enamel, or pulp tissue once a permanent tooth is extracted.

2. What That Hard White Bump Actually Is: Spicules, Sequestra, and Roots

If extracted teeth cannot regrow, what causes the unmistakable sensation of a hard, jagged tooth emerging from the old surgical site? Oral surgeons encounter four distinct clinical phenomena that explain this common experience:

  • Bone Spicules and Crestal Remodeling: After a molar is extracted, the empty tooth socket does not heal overnight. The surrounding alveolar ridge undergoes extensive osteoclastic remodeling over twelve to twenty-four months. During this process, micro-fragments of thin cortical bone naturally detach and work their way outward through the gum tissue. These bone spicules feel razor-sharp to the tongue and look chalky white, perfectly imitating an erupting cusp.
  • Bony Sequestra: In cases of complex surgical extraction, a localized portion of avascular bone may separate from the healing jaw. The body recognizes this non-vital fragment as a foreign object and slowly exfoliates it toward the oral surface.
  • Intentional Retained Root Tips (Coronectomy): In select surgical cases where wisdom tooth roots closely wrap around or compress the inferior alveolar nerve canal, an oral surgeon may intentionally perform a coronectomy. The coronal crown is completely excised, while healthy, vital root tips are left anchored deep within the bone to eliminate nerve injury risks. Over several years, biological eruptive forces may gently migrate these root fragments coronally, bringing them into view.
  • Hyperkeratinized Scar Tissue: Surgical sites often heal with dense fibrous connective tissue. This scar tissue can become firm, elevated, and mildly sensitive to masticatory pressure, creating a tactile illusion of an emerging tooth.

3. Differential Diagnosis of Post-Extraction Sensations: Comparison Table

Differentiating harmless post-operative bone remodeling from structural remnants or supernumerary teeth requires evaluating timing, clinical appearance, and radiographic findings:

Clinical Finding Typical Onset Window Physical Characteristics Standard Management Protocol
Alveolar Bone Spicule 2 to 8 weeks post-op Sharp, tiny, chalky white fragment; tender to tongue touch Self-exfoliation or gentle chairside removal with cotton forceps
Bony Sequestrum 1 to 6 months post-op Larger firm cortical fragment; mild localized gum erythema Minor in-office curettage under local anesthesia
Migrated Root Remnant 6 months to 5 years post-op Smooth or jagged dentin surface emerging from healed mucosa Simple superficial retrieval; nerve is no longer adjacent
Supernumerary Fourth Molar (Distomolar) Years after initial surgery Fully formed anatomical molar crown with enamel and root system Targeted surgical extraction under local or IV sedation

In very rare clinical instances (approximately one to two percent of the population), a patient develops a genuine supernumerary tooth behind or alongside the third molar site. Known medically as a distomolar or paramolar, this fourth molar forms from an aberrant extra dental lamina bud during embryonic development. Because these extra molars often sit higher in the maxillary tuberosity or deeper within the mandibular ramus, they may remain undetected on standard two-dimensional radiographs until years after the primary wisdom teeth have been removed.

At our practice, Dr. Johanny Caceres utilizes 3D cone-beam computed tomography (CBCT) to evaluate any unexpected post-surgical sensations. High-resolution volumetric imaging reveals whether you are dealing with a harmless bone sliver that can be lifted away in seconds, an intentional root fragment requiring observation, or a genuine supernumerary tooth.
